Article: Captivate Network Lights Up First Internet Screens in Elevators of San Francisco, Los Angeles, Dallas, Houston; Company Also Establishes Advertising Sales offices in Each Market.

Business/Technology Editors

WESTFORD, Mass.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Aug. 21, 2000

Captivate Network, Inc., the new media company that is bringing the Internet to the elevator, announced today that it has started the second phase of its nationwide expansion with the introduction of its high resolution, flat panel digital screens in several of the nation's landmark office towers including 201 Mission, 550 South Hope, Fountain Place and Post Oak Central located in San Francisco, Los Angeles, Dallas and Houston respectively.
